Trump refuses Christmas greetings to 37 'violent criminals' commuted by Biden: 'Go to hell'
Thursday, 26 December 2024 President-elect Trump refused to wish clemency-granted federal death-row inmates a merry Christmas, telling them to 'go to Hell.' He criticized Biden for commuting their sentences and targeted China, Canada, and 'Radical Left Lunatics' in his holiday message. Trump's message ended with promises to 'MAKE AMERICA GREAT AGAIN' in 26 days.
